Hi,

I have cp-251 and when I plug the Noise-out into my volume pedal I get the noise but also a hum or buzz (I don´t know the appropriate term in english for german "brummen").

It sounds like it´s coming from the house electricity, but I only get it from the noise output on the cp-251, not from the LFO or other ouptuts on the cp-251, so it can´t be the wallwart, right?

Anyone knows a solution? Should I return it?

I´d appreciate any suggestions...

What happens if you bypass the volume pedal and run the noise-out directly into your amp (set at low volume)? Have you tried different cables?

It's possible that the buzz is coming from the wall-wart (the Noise is the only audio output, so a buzz will probably only be apparent there), but more likely the buzz is caused by a ground loop. Try different cables, different power (another outlet), etc. The idea here is to systematically eliminate each element to get to the source of the problem.

thanks for the replies.

I tried the thing into my bass amp and into a mixing console both with Mono (TS?) & Stereo (RTS?) cables, testing two moog wallwarts in 2 houses.
I always get the hum which is as loud as the noise itself.
Just to be sure, the noise should be white noise?

Again, there´s no hum when I connect the LFO to the audio inputs.
